Black Mesa (2020) reimagines the classic Half-Life experience with modern graphics and mechanics, plunging players into the secretive Black Mesa Research Facility. You step into the shoes of scientist Gordon Freeman, whose routine experiment goes catastrophically wrong, tearing open a rift to an alien world known as Xen. As the facility descends into chaos, Freeman must navigate collapsing labs, hostile creatures, and military forces sent to contain the disaster by any means necessary. Along the way, he uncovers the hidden truths behind the facility’s experiments and the consequences of human ambition. Dying Light is set in the quarantined city of Harran, which has been devastated by a deadly virus that turns people into violent infected. You play as Kyle Crane, an undercover agent sent to infiltrate the city and recover important stolen data. His mission begins as a simple covert operation, but it quickly becomes complicated as he gets involved with the local survivor communities. As Crane explores Harran, he learns to navigate both the infected threats and the hostile human factions fighting for control. Over time, he discovers that his employers may not be as trustworthy as they first appeared. The story takes a darker turn as the origins of the virus and unethical experiments behind it are revealed. Crane is forced to make difficult moral choices that affect the people he meets and the outcome of his mission. In the end, the game focuses on survival, betrayal, and whether he will remain loyal to his orders or protect the survivors of Harran.

Assassin's Creed III Remastered immerses players in a richly updated version of the American Revolution, blending historical events with a personal story of identity and justice. You step into the role of Connor (Ratonhnhaké:ton), a Native American Assassin fighting to protect his people and land as tensions rise between the Colonies and the British Empire in 1775. As war erupts, Connor becomes entangled with both Patriots and Templars, including his own father, creating a conflict that is as personal as it is political. The remaster enhances the experience with improved graphics, refined gameplay, and more immersive environments, making cities, forests, and battlefields feel more alive. Players can explore diverse settings, engage in stealth assassinations or open combat, and influence key historical moments. The package also includes all DLCs like The Tyranny of King Washington and Assassin's Creed Liberation Remastered, expanding the narrative with new perspectives and missions. Assassin's Creed Syndicate is an action-adventure title set in the vibrant, dangerous world of Victorian London, where players take control of twin Assassins Jacob and Evie Frye, each offering distinct playstyles. Jacob excels in aggressive, fast-paced combat with brutal combos and brawling techniques, while Evie specializes in stealth, precision, and silent assassinations. The game’s open world recreates iconic landmarks like Buckingham Palace and Big Ben, letting players traverse the city using parkour, carriages, and even moving trains. Beyond exploration, players build and lead a gang to challenge rival factions and liberate London’s districts from Templar control. Missions range from high-speed chases to strategic infiltrations, blending action with stealth-driven gameplay. The industrial setting adds a unique flavor, with steamboats, factories, and crowded streets shaping the experience. With its dual-character system and dynamic city, the game delivers a rich mix of combat, strategy, and exploration.

Grand Theft Auto: San Andreas – The Definitive Edition is a modernized version of the iconic open-world classic, bringing enhanced visuals, improved lighting, high-resolution textures, and updated controls inspired by Grand Theft Auto V. Set in the early 1990s, the story follows Carl “CJ” Johnson as he returns to Los Santos after his mother’s murder, only to find his family broken and his neighborhood in chaos. Framed by corrupt police, CJ is forced into a sprawling journey across the state of San Andreas, navigating gang conflicts, crime, and personal struggles. The game blends narrative-driven missions with vast open-world freedom, allowing players to explore cities, countryside, and deserts. Widely regarded as one of the most influential titles in gaming, it helped define the sandbox genre. This definitive edition preserves the original’s depth while refining its presentation for a new generation.
